Maintaining and Replacing Wheel Hubs on Your 1993 Mitsubishi Pajero

Keeping your 1993 Mitsubishi Pajero in top condition involves routine maintenance, and one component that shouldn't be overlooked is the wheel hubs. These essential parts ensure your wheels rotate smoothly and support the vehicle's weight. Over time, wheel hubs can wear down due to constant use, road conditions, and the accumulation of dirt and moisture, which can lead to decreased performance or even failure. Let's dive into how to identify when it might be time for a replacement and some general maintenance tips to keep them in optimal shape.

The wheel hub assembly of a 1993 Mitsubishi Pajero is a critical component of the vehicle's wheel system. This assembly creates less friction and wear, helps to ensure safe operation, and provides a smooth ride. When it comes to maintenance, there are several signs that might indicate the need for attention or replacement:

  1. Noise: Listen for a growling or humming noise when driving. This could indicate that your wheel hub bearings are failing.
  2. Vibration: If you experience a wobble or vibration in the steering wheel, especially at higher speeds, it could be due to a problem with the wheel hub.
  3. ABS Warning Light: If the ABS (Anti-lock Braking System) warning light is triggered, it might be related to the wheel speed sensor on the hub.
  4. Wheel Play: Check for any excessive movement in the wheel when the car is on a lift or jack. This could signify worn-out bearings within the hub assembly.

Replacing a wheel hub is a task that can be tackled by those with mechanical proficiency, though always consider seeking professional help if you're unsure. If DIY is your forte, here's a simple guideline:

  1. Securely lift the vehicle and remove the wheel.
  2. Remove the brake caliper and rotor to access the hub assembly.
  3. Remove the old hub assembly by unscrewing the necessary bolts.
  4. Install the new hub, ensuring it is properly aligned and tightened.
  5. Reattach the brake rotor and caliper, then put the wheel back on.

Even if your wheel hubs seem fine, regular checks can prevent future issues. Consider cleaning and inspecting them during routine services to stop contaminants from building up, which can lead to premature wear. Lubricating the bearings and ensuring all components are secure and free of rust are small steps that can prolong their life.
